Why Your First Consultation Matters
Your first meeting with an immigration attorney is more than just an introduction—it’s a chance to assess their expertise, communication style, and ability to handle your specific immigration case. Not all lawyers are created equal, and choosing the wrong one can lead to delays, additional costs, or even denials.
Here’s what you need to ask to make the best choice.
1. What Is Your Experience Handling Cases Like Mine?
Not all immigration attorneys specialize in the same areas. Some focus on family-based petitions, while others handle employment visas or asylum cases. Be specific about your needs and ask:
How many cases like mine have you handled?
What was the outcome of similar cases?
How long have you been practicing immigration law?
Are you a member of the American Immigration Lawyers Association (AILA)?
Why It Matters:
Experience can mean the difference between an approved application and a rejection. An attorney familiar with your type of case will anticipate challenges and help you avoid costly mistakes.
2. What Are My Best Options for Immigration Relief?
Your immigration situation might have multiple paths. A knowledgeable attorney should be able to explain your options, including:
Different visa categories you might qualify for
Whether you should pursue a green card now or later
Any risks or red flags that could affect your case
Alternative solutions if your preferred path isn’t available
Why It Matters:
A good immigration lawyer should outline the pros and cons of each option and help you choose the best strategy for your long-term immigration goals.
3. What Are the Potential Challenges in My Case?
Immigration cases often involve legal and bureaucratic hurdles. Ask the attorney:
What obstacles could arise in my case?
Have you handled cases with similar complications before?
How do you address Requests for Evidence (RFEs) or denials?
Why It Matters:
A competent lawyer will be upfront about potential risks and explain how they will handle them.
4. What Are Your Fees and Payment Plans?
Legal fees can vary widely, so it’s important to discuss costs upfront. Ask:
What is your fee structure? (Flat fee or hourly?)
Are there additional costs for filing fees, document translation, or expert witnesses?
Do you offer payment plans?
Why It Matters:
Knowing the full cost of legal representation will help you budget and avoid unexpected expenses.
5. Who Will Be Handling My Case?
At some law firms, the attorney you meet may not be the one actually working on your case. Ask:
Will you personally handle my case, or will it be assigned to a paralegal or junior attorney?
How can I contact you with questions?
What is your typical response time?
Why It Matters:
You want to ensure that your case is not just handed off to someone without experience and that you can communicate directly with the attorney when needed.
6. What Documents Do I Need to Provide?
Proper documentation is key to any immigration case. Ask:
What forms and evidence do I need to gather?
Do I need certified translations for my documents?
Will you help me obtain missing documents?
Why It Matters:
Providing the correct documentation upfront can prevent delays and reduce the chances of receiving an RFE.
7. How Long Will My Case Take?
Immigration processes can take months or even years. Ask:
How long does my specific application type usually take?
What factors could cause delays?
Can you expedite my case if needed?
Why It Matters:
Understanding the timeline will help you plan accordingly, especially if you have job offers, family reunifications, or other time-sensitive situations.
8. What Happens If My Case Is Denied?
No one wants to think about rejection, but it’s important to be prepared. Ask:
What are my options if my application is denied?
Can you assist with appeals or motions to reopen?
Have you successfully handled appeals before?
Why It Matters:
A strong immigration attorney should have a plan in place if things don’t go as expected.
9. How Do You Stay Updated on Immigration Law Changes?
Immigration laws change frequently, especially under different administrations. Ask:
How do you keep up with policy updates?
Are you involved in any professional immigration law organizations?
Have you handled cases under recent policy changes?
Why It Matters:
You want an attorney who stays informed and adapts to legal changes to give you the best possible representation.
10. Why Should I Hire You Over Another Immigration Attorney?
This is your chance to hear the attorney’s pitch on why they are the best choice for your case. Ask:
What sets you apart from other immigration attorneys?
How do you ensure a personalized approach to each client?
Can you provide references or client testimonials?
Why It Matters:
A good attorney should be able to explain what makes them uniquely qualified to handle your case successfully.
